SQL 获取今天的当月开始结束范围:

使用 GETDATE() 结合 DATEADD()DATEDIFF() 函数来获取当前月的开始和结束时间范围。以下是实现当前月时间范围查询的 SQL:

sql 复制代码
FDATE >= DATEADD(MONTH, DATEDIFF(MONTH, 0, GETDATE()), 0)
FDATE < DATEADD(MONTH, DATEDIFF(MONTH, 0, GETDATE()) + 1, 0)

现在是2024年12月份

相关推荐
解决问题no解决代码问题20 分钟前
oracle删除表与表空间清理机制
数据库·oracle
程序员三明治1 小时前
【Mybatis从入门到入土】ResultMap映射、多表查询与缓存机制全解析
java·sql·缓存·mybatis·resultmap·缓存机制·多表查询
洲覆1 小时前
Redis 事务机制:Pipeline、ACID、Lua脚本
数据库·redis·缓存·lua
CHHC18801 小时前
SQLite批量操作优化方案
数据库·sqlite
keep intensify1 小时前
Redis基础指令全解析:从入门到精通
linux·数据库·c++·redis
曹牧1 小时前
oracle:To_char
数据库·oracle
DemonAvenger1 小时前
深入浅出Redis List:从基础到实战,10年经验的后端工程师带你解锁最佳实践
数据库·redis·性能优化
摘星编程2 小时前
Vector数据库性能大比武:Pinecone、Weaviate、Chroma速度与准确率实测
数据库
CodeBlossom2 小时前
Redis速通
数据库·redis·缓存
牛奶咖啡132 小时前
MySQL InnoDB Cluster 高可用集群部署与应用实践(下)
数据库·mysql·innodb cluster·mysql router·mysql路由的安装部署·mysql路由的测试·mgr组复制